Elgin Community College is located in Elgin, IL.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 33 industrial mechanics & maintenance degrees were granted at Elgin Community College.

Online & Distance Learning at Elgin Community College

Online coursework is an option at Elgin Community College. Among 10,251 students, 1,268 (12%) studied exclusively online and 2,609 (25%) took at least some classes online.
